Standard ECMA-130
Data Interchange on Read-only 120 mm
Optical Data Disks (CD-ROM)
2nd edition (June 1996)
This Ecma Standard specifies the characteristics of 120 mm optical
disks for information interchange between information processing
systems and for information storage, called CD-ROM.
The optical disk specified by this Standard is of the type in
which the information is recorded before delivery to the user
and can only be read from the disk.
This Standard specifies:
- some definitions, the environments in which the characteristics
of the disk shall be tested and the environments in which it
shall be used and stored,
- the mechanical, physical and dimensional characteristics of
the disk,
- the recording characteristics, the format of the tracks, the
error-detecting and the error-correcting characters, and the
coding of the information,
- the optical characteristics for reading the information.
These characteristics are specified for tracks recorded with
digital data. According to this Standard, a disk may also contain
one or more tracks recorded with digital audio data. Such tracks
shall be recorded according to IEC Publication 908.
